A pair of shorts made using sewaholic’s Thurlow pattern. slightly tailored with turned up hems. welt pockets and contrast facings.

An outfit based on one seen in Pan Am. A Top and skirt combo, the top, is quite lose but does have small bust darts, and the skirt is a pencil style with centre back zip.
